The PGA Tour revealed its schedule for the 2027 season, which includes a new tournament, The American Express, starting January 21-24., two events will be held at Pebble Beach, including the U.S. Open in June. The Cadillac Championship has been relocated to March and will now act as a prelude to the majors. The tour recently canceled both the Kapalua and Sony Open events, transitioning the latter to the PGA Tour Champions. The modifications to the schedule reflect ongoing adjustments within the tour's structure.
